Transaction 1761963f22114dafa9e7ea7d343fd977638cc43574c448e3b23e201bf15e6840
1 Input
1 Output
-
1761963f22114dafa9e7ea7d343fd977638cc43574c448e3b23e201bf15e6840:0
- value
- 16691
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 818a8a417bc337c85424c2966506f3ade5ebc80c OP_EQUAL
- address
- 3DVy4DqTfy7vgugFbjAkaRWNYFZvMUXBk4